Transaction dd960420427f694a737b60c9bc779a166e437292b018fa03d6d801bae1735f5c
1 Input
1 Output
-
dd960420427f694a737b60c9bc779a166e437292b018fa03d6d801bae1735f5c:0
- value
- 634940255
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c38958ff919c72a068b0df183d65cf3c7cc1fbc6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JpuJVMmaQspfuxGPTUaQ1sEVY8J2Hh6GT